arrows for new Pearson Predator
 
Hello Everyone,

This is my first post here, have been reading forever. Ordered a new Pearson Quad 440 but the factory ran out and to my benifit I received a Predator (thanks hunter's friend) with the 400 Quad's accessories. To this I added a TKO fall away rest. It came with 4 Carbon Express Terminator 60-75 arrows. Bow was shipped at 62lbs, 28". I backed the lbs down to 58, and it is still 28 " length, and the arrows are cut at 28.5". I use 100 grain field points and Chuck Adams spear point broadheads.

Are these arrows (10.7 g per inch) too heavy for 58 lbs. I'm stuck in limbo if I stay carbon express which I like, as they range60-75 or 45-60 (are they too light?) for the terminator. I'll also be open to try Easton, beman, etc. What do you all think?
